The United Nations projects that nearly 68% of the global population will live in urban areas by 2050. This ongoing urbanization wave is not just expanding existing ride-hailing markets — it is creating entirely new ones in cities and regions that had no formal on-demand transport infrastructure five years ago.
Simultaneously, established operators in mature urban markets are discovering strong demand in suburban regions. Uber has started targeting suburban areas with lower public transport density to expand its customer base and meet rising demand for flexible transit in those zones. This suburban expansion trend is driven by the same forces as urban adoption — traffic congestion, parking costs, and the appeal of on-demand over car ownership — but in a context that requires different vehicle supply strategies, different pricing models, and different zone configurations than dense city centers.

Fleet electrification is accelerating across the ride-hailing industry at a pace that is outpacing most early projections. Over 350,000 electric vehicles were dedicated to ride-hailing services worldwide by end-2024, and 14 large operators committed to electrifying more than 100,000 vehicles between 2023 and 2026. Electrification pledges from major platforms like Uber are coming faster than expected, with active partnerships with vehicle manufacturers and charging providers increasing EV availability.
For operators, this transition creates specific operational challenges that a conventional ride-hailing platform is not equipped to handle: range-aware dispatch that accounts for battery state, charging window management during natural demand lulls, and battery health monitoring that prevents vehicles from being dispatched on trips they cannot complete.

Ride-hailing globally has moved into a more regulated stage. Discussions on worker classification in the United States and Europe are affecting cost structures. Minimum wage rules and insurance requirements are increasing platform liabilities. Cities like London and Singapore are implementing congestion pricing frameworks that directly affect operating costs. Twelve US states implemented or updated ride-hailing regulations between 2022 and 2024 alone. Malaysia revoked a platform's operating permit for compliance lapses, demonstrating that regulatory risk is existential, not theoretical.
For operators, navigating this regulatory environment requires platforms that support compliance documentation, reporting, and enforcement of local operational rules — not just platforms that enable bookings.

A notable trend in the ride-hailing market is the evolution of platforms into multi-modal mobility providers and super apps. In 2024, 28% of ride-hailing bookings used integrated transit and micro-mobility options alongside traditional ride-hailing. Go-Jek began as a motorcycle ride-hailing service and evolved into a super-app offering ride-hailing, food delivery, digital payments, and healthcare. Rapido entered the online travel space in October 2025 by partnering with RedBus, Goibibo, and ConfirmTkt — positioning itself as India's first mobility-led one-stop travel platform.
Passengers increasingly expect their ride-hailing app to be part of a broader mobility ecosystem — not a standalone service that exists in isolation from other transport options, payment systems, or service categories.

The ride-hailing market is witnessing growing demand for subscription-based pricing models. Subscription plans — offering fixed monthly ride allowances, commuter passes, or premium membership tiers — are gaining popularity as they enhance customer retention and create predictable revenue streams for operators. Major trends in the next forecast period explicitly include subscription-based ride packages and corporate partnerships for employee transportation.

The ride-hailing industry in 2025 faces real macro-economic headwinds: fuel cost volatility driven by geopolitical tensions, semiconductor shortages affecting vehicle supply, tariff pressures on imported tech components, and inflationary wage pressures on driver earnings.
Operators on platforms that lack dynamic pricing tools, cost-control features, and flexible commission structures are highly exposed to these pressures — they cannot pass costs through without losing passengers, and they cannot absorb costs without losing margins.
